About the role

  • Unstructured is a cutting-edge technology company at the forefront of developing innovative solutions for processing and extracting insights from unstructured data. Our mission is to empower businesses with actionable intelligence derived from text, images, and other unstructured sources.
  • Recognized as the industry leader in ETL for LLMs, Unstructured has been downloaded more than 38 million times and is trusted by over 60,000 companies—including nearly half of the Fortune 500. We’ve also been named the #24 Most Innovative Company in the World by Fast Company and are proud to be featured in the Forbes AI50 list.
  • We are looking for a Technical Product Marketing Leader to own messaging and comms strategy for Unstructured. You’ll work in lockstep with Product Managers, Engineering, Marketing and Sales to bring product innovations to life, craft compelling product and business stories, and drive adoption across a technically sophisticated audience.
  • The ideal candidate is deeply technical, understands developer workflows and enterprise infrastructure, and thrives at the intersection of storytelling and software.
  • Key Responsibilities
  • Product Marketing Strategy and Positioning
  • Own and continuously evolve the core messaging and positioning for Unstructured
  • Translate product capabilities into value propositions and technical narratives tailored to developers, data engineers, and enterprise decision-makers
  • Conduct competitive analysis and market research to identify trends, white space opportunities, and differentiation levers
  • Cross-functional Product Collaboration
  • Partner with Product Managers to shape feature launch strategy, positioning, and messaging from the earliest stages of development
  • Collaborate closely with Engineering and Product to understand the technical roadmap and translate it into externally facing communications
  • Work with Sales and Customer Success to gather feedback from technical buyers and integrate it into positioning and content strategy
  • Content and Enablement
  • Create and maintain technical marketing assets, including datasheets, solution briefs, whitepapers, demo scripts, battlecards, and presentations
  • Own and produce technical blog posts, product update writeups, and release announcements that engage the community and explain complex concepts clearly
  • Deliver and scale internal enablement through product walkthroughs, competitive briefings, and objection-handling materials
  •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in a technical field (e.g., Computer Science, Engineering, Data Science); MBA or advanced technical degree is a plus.
  • 5–8 years of experience in technical product marketing, solutions engineering, technical evangelism, or related roles for a software product.
  • Deep familiarity with ETL pipelines, LLMs, data infrastructure, or developer platforms.
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ills – able to craft stories that resonate with both technical and business stakeholders.
  • Demonstrated success in marketing technical products
  • Comfortable operating independently in a fast-paced, ambiguous, and highly collaborative startup culture.
